CPI-U - Consumer Price Index for All Urban Consumers is a measurement of the average change over time in prices paid by consumers for consumer goods and services, maintained by the Bureau of Labor Statistics of the U.S. Department of Labor. You are bidding noncompetitively when you purchase Treasury marketable securities through TreasuryDirect. The maximum amount for a noncompetitive purchase is $10 million. Primary Owner - A Primary Owner type of registration denotes the first-named registrant in the registration of a security held in TreasuryDirect (e.g., registered "John Doe SSN 123-45-6789 WITH Joseph Doe SSN 987-65-4321"). Original Issue Holding Period - TreasuryDirect requires Treasury marketable securities originally issued in an account be held for 45 days before they may be transferred. IRS Name Control - A name control is a sequence of characters, generally the first four characters of a taxpayers last name or the first four letters of a business name. Grantor - As the first-named registrant, a TreasuryDirect account holder (or grantor) may grant View or Transact rights to a grantee based on the type of security registration. View Rights - On a security with Sole Owner registration, the first-named registrant (or grantor) may grant View rights to any individual (or grantee) with a TreasuryDirect account.
